One of the most effective ways to enhance energy efficiency in HVAC systems is through smart thermostats. Unlike traditional thermostats, smart thermostats learn your schedule and preferences to optimize heating and cooling patterns. By adjusting accordingly when you're away or asleep, these devices minimize unnecessary energy consumption, resulting in significant cost savings. With the added convenience of remote control via smartphone apps, smart thermostats ensure you can manage your home's climate from anywhere.
Advancements in HVAC technology have also led to the development of high-efficiency heat pumps. These devices go beyond the capabilities of standard air conditioners and heaters by transferring heat rather than generating it, making them ideal for moderate climates. Modern heat pumps provide both heating and cooling with impressive efficiency, often consuming up to 50% less electricity compared to older systems. Consider this an upgrade that not only reduces energy bills but also enhances year-round comfort.
Incorporating zoned HVAC systems can drastically reduce energy waste. Zoning allows you to heat or cool different areas of your home independently. This is particularly beneficial for larger homes where certain sections might not be used frequently. By only directing air to occupied spaces, zoned systems avoid unnecessary energy expenditure, making them a smart choice for reducing utility bills without compromising comfort. Installation of dampers in ductwork can make the transition to a zoned system smoother and more effective.
Another game-changing innovation is the application of variable-speed technology in HVAC systems. Traditional systems can be inefficient due to their reliance on a single-speed compressor. In contrast, variable-speed compressors adjust their speed to meet heating or cooling demands more precisely. This results in smooth, consistent temperatures and reduced energy consumption, as the system doesn't need to repeatedly power on and off. Reduced cycling not only saves energy but also minimizes wear and tear, leading to longer system lifespan and reduced maintenance costs.
For those looking to make eco-friendly choices, geothermal HVAC systems offer a sustainable solution. These systems leverage the earth’s stable underground temperatures to provide efficient heating and cooling year-round. While the initial investment can be higher, the returns come in the form of considerably lower long-term energy costs and reduced greenhouse gas emissions. Geothermal systems are a viable option for homeowners committed to sustainability.
